Is there a way to get rid of the ants nests in my lawn organically?

💡 Our Advice
Try Ant Killer Granules from Neudorff mixed with water and poured over the nest to kill the colony. This is approved by Organic Farmers and Growers. Alternatively, apply a biological control such as No Ants (Nemasys) which uses nematodes (eelworms) to kill young ants and drive away adults from the nest.
